PASMA
Towers for Managers
Who Should Attend
Any person who has responsibility for managing people who use mobile access towers, ensuring that work is properly planned and organised, that those involved in carrying out the work are competent, and that towers are correctly inspected and maintained.
​
Course Aim
To learn about current legislation, regulations and guidance affecting working at height using mobile access towers.
​
Training Methods
Instruction both in theory and practical sessions. Assessment is via a closed book course with a pass mark of 80% in both theory and practical.
​
Course Content:
• Legislation, Regulations and Guidance affecting working at height with mobile access towers
• Code of Practice
• Instruction Manuals
• Fall Protection
• Fault Finding
• Case Studies
• Inspection Records
• Hazards
• Risk Assessments & Rescue Plans
• Behavioural Competencies
Additional Info
No formal qualifications needed but it would be envisaged that you will have a good working knowledge of the Work at Height Regulations and Health & Safety at Work Act 1974.
PPE Requirements
None required.
